Campeón bate en 1942-43 (.342) y 1944-45 (.425)…único jugador que fue campeón bate, sub-campeón y campeón bate en tres temporadas consecutivas (1942-43, 1943-44 y (1944-45)…líder en dobles en 1945-46 (12)…líder en carreras anotadas en 1941-42 (46)…líder en hits (59) y bases robadas (20) en 1943-44…ocupa el segundo lugar en bateo de por vida (.337)…uno de cuatro en batear dos veces .400+ (los otros son Perucho Cepeda, Tetelo Vargas y Willard Brown)…bateador de más contacto en la historia de la Liga, se ponchó 20 veces en 1,750 turnos (no incluye primera temporada) para ratio de un ponche cada 87.50 turnos…en tres temporadas consecutivas, 1939-40, 1940-41 y 1941-42, no tuvo ponches…cuatro veces tuvo más jonrones que ponches e igual cantidad de jonrones y ponches, también en cuatro ocasiones:
1939-40 (2 jonrones y 0 ponches)
1940-41 (3 jonrones y 0 ponches)
1941-42 (5 jonrones y 0 ponches)
1943-44 (1 jonrón y 1 ponche)
1944-45 (1 jonrón y 1 ponche)
1945-46 (2 jonrones y 2 ponches)
1947-48 (4 jonrones y 4 ponches)
1948-49 (3 jonrones y 1 ponche)
Electo al Pabellón de la Fama del Deporte Puertorriqueño en 1958, Salón de la Fama del Béisbol Profesional Puertorriqueño 1991 y en el 2013 fue seleccionado como uno de los mejores 75 jugadores de la Liga de Béisbol Profesional del Puerto Rico.
Batting champion in 1942-43 (.342) and 1944-45 (.425)… The only player to be batting champion, runner-up and batting champion in three consecutive seasons (1942-43, 1943-44 and (1944-45)… leader in doubles in 1945-46 (12)… leader in runs scored in 1941-42 (46)… leader in hits (59) and stolen bases (20) in 1943-44… He ranks second in career batting (.337)… one of four to hit .400+ twice (the others are Perucho Cepeda, Tetelo Vargas and Willard Brown)… The most contact hitter in league history, he struck out 20 times in 1,750 at-bats (not including first season) for a strikeout ratio of one per 87.50 at-bats… In three consecutive seasons, 1939-40, 1940-41 and 1941-42, he had no strikeouts… Four times he had more home runs than strikeouts and the same number of home runs and strikeouts, also on four occasions:
1939-40 (2 home runs, 0 strikeouts)
1940-41 (3 home runs and 0 strikeouts)
1941-42 (5 home runs and 0 strikeouts)
1943-44 (1 home run and 1 strikeout)
1944-45 (1 home run and 1 strikeout)
1945-46 (2 home runs and 2 strikeouts)
1947-48 (4 home runs and 4 strikeouts)
1948-49 (3 home runs and 1 strikeout)
He was elected to the Puerto Rican Sports Hall of Fame in 1958, the Puerto Rican Professional Baseball Hall of Fame in 1991 and in 2013 he was selected as one of the best 75 players in the Puerto Rico Professional Baseball League.
